Am 21.05.13 11:36, schrieb David Bruchmann:
Dann würde ich es mal als Bug posten.
Ein Rundungsproblem wie Du es beschrieben hast wird ja schon durch ein
einfaches
intval() oder (int) Value
hervorgerufen, wenn die Zahl anschließend mit zwei Nullstellen
formatiert wird, siehts halt anders aus aber bleibt falsch.
da ja die Nachkommastellen abgeschnitten werden würde ich mal das
Trennzeichen unter die Lupe nehmen. Im Deutschen wird da ja auch
abweichend zum üblichen Handling das Komma statt eines Punktes
verwendet. Kommas wiederum werden häufig als Trennzeichen für Listen
benutzt.
meine erste Idee bei der Problembeschreibung war: da wird nur der Teil
vor dem Komma benutzt und direkt für/in(?) der Ausgabe addiert (evtl.
sogar im Javascript?)
beim Speichern wird wohl wieder Float benutzt und dann die Summe für
die gecachte Seite aus den float-Zahlen korrekt berechnet.
bernd
unter diesem Aspekt mal die EInstelluneg für sprintf() bzw.
entsprechende wrapper-funktion prüfen, evtl. läßt sich das in der
Erweiterung per TypoScript einstellen - oder die Funktion verwendet
globale Einstellungen dafür aus den locals oder aus dem TypoScript-Setup
_______________________________________________
TYPO3-german mailing list
TYPO3-german@lists.typo3.org
http://lists.typo3.org/cgi-bin/mailman/listinfo/typo3-german